A solar-powered Rankine cycle power plant uses 18.5 × 103 m2 of solar collectors. Refrigerant-22 is used as the working fluid at a flow rate of 1.00 kg/s and is transformed to a saturated vapor in the solar collectors (which function as the boiler) at a temperature of 40.0°C.
The condenser for the system operates at 20.0°C and has a quality of 0.00 at the exit. The pump and prime mover isentropic efficiencies are 65.0% and 75.0%, respectively.
Determine the prime mover power output and system thermal efficiency when the incident solar flux is 8.00 W/m2 .
